
Hydrocyclone
The hydrocyclone is a simple piece of equipment that uses fluid pressure to generate centrifugal force and a flow pattern which can separate particles or droplets from a liquid medium. These particles or droplets must have a sufficiently different density relative to the medium in order to achieve separation.It is a high technological enterprise that …

Deoiling Hydrocyclone
Hydrocyclone works Produced water, pumped or under pressure from the separators, is fed into the hydrocyclone vessel and makes its way to the multiple inlet ports of each liner. The pressure difference between the inlet and outlet ports of the liner ensures the correct flow path. An axially positioned swirl inducer immediately creates a rotation

SPE 28815 The Separation of Solids and Liquids with …
hydrocyclone a "desander". Liquid-liquid separation as applied in the removal of residual oil from produced water will be defined as "deoiling" and that hydrocyclone a "deoiler". The dehydration, or liquid-liquid separation of water from crude, will be defined as "dewatering" and that hydrocyclone a "dewaterer". In all cases, the discussion will be
